This interview podcast focuses on overcoming nervousness and fear, specifically addressing a guest's fear of flying. The host, Mel Robbins, begins by discussing the guest's anxiety surrounding an upcoming flight and then shares her own past struggles with aviophobia. Mel introduces the "confidence anchor" technique, a four-step process involving identifying a related exciting element, visualizing it, and repeatedly stating "I'm excited." This technique, backed by research from Harvard Business School and UCLA, aims to reframe negative anticipatory anxiety into positive excitement by leveraging the body's similar physiological responses to both emotions. Listeners learn a practical method to manage anxiety in various situations by replacing negative self-talk with positive affirmations focused on anticipated positive outcomes.
